The death of Egyptian captain Saeed Abdulaziz Salama has been reported, following an attack on a Russian cargo ship near a Russian port by Ukrainian shelling. This event occurs amid escalating crises faced by Egyptian sailors in maritime areas marked by security tensions, particularly off the Somali coast, where efforts to secure the release of eight Egyptian sailors still continue. It is noted that the ship "Nouran" was carrying 13 sailors, including nine Egyptians, and was attacked by six Ukrainian drones. The body of the captain is expected to be returned to Egypt after Russian procedures. Sources confirm that the security background of these operations complicates the sailors' situation, amid ongoing negotiations with pirates, with Egyptian calls for caution before sailing into conflict zones.
